Proverbs 22:26 Interlinear
“ Be not thou one of them that strike hands or of them that are sureties for debts”
Word-by-Word Analysis
| # | Original | Strong's | English | Definition |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| אַל | H408 | not (the qualified negation, used as a deprecative); once (job 24:25) as a noun, nothing | |
| 2 | תְּהִ֥י | H1961 | to exist, i.e., be or become, come to pass (always emphatic, and not a mere copula or auxiliary) | |
| 3 | בְתֹֽקְעֵי | H8628 | Be not thou one of them that strike | to clatter, i.e., slap (the hands together), clang (an instrument); by analogy, to drive (a nail or tent-pin, a dart, etc.); by implication, to become |
| 4 | כָ֑ף | H3709 | hands | the hollow hand or palm (so of the paw of an animal, of the sole, and even of the bowl of a dish or sling, the handle of a bolt, the leaves of a palm- |
| 5 | בַּ֝עֹרְבִ֗ים | H6148 | or of them that are sureties | to braid, i.e., intermix; technically, to traffic (as if by barter); also or give to be security (as a kind of exchange) |
| 6 | מַשָּׁאֽוֹת׃ | H4859 | for debts | a loan |
